文档介绍:水温控制系统
摘要:
本水温控制系统采用PT100高精度热电阻温度传感器,经调理电路转化为电压信号送LPC2378(ARM7)处理器进行处理,。控制系统为仿人智能PID算法,实现了温度调节的快速性和稳定性,温控超调量小,稳态调节时间短。控制输出采用脉冲移相触发可控硅来调节加热管的功率,采用固态继电器控制水泵及半导体制冷片的液冷系统实现快速降温。可以实现在10-70的范围内对水温的动态调节。
关键字:PT100,PID控制,可控硅
设计题目及要求:
(1)可键盘设定控制温度值,并能用液晶显示,℃
(2)可以测量并显示水的实际温度。℃内;
(3)水温控制系统应具有全量程(10℃—70℃)内的升温、降温功能(降温可用半导体制冷片、升温用800W以内的电加热器);
(4)在全量程内任意设定一个温度值(例如起始温度+15℃内),控制系统可以实现该给定温度的恒值自动控制。控制的最大动态误差≤±4℃,静态误差≤±1℃,系统达到稳态的时间≤15min(最少两个波动周期)。
(5)当设定温度突变(温度变化+20℃)时,控制的最大动态误差≤±2℃,系统达到稳态的时间≤8min(最少两个波动周期);
(6)温度控制的静态误差≤±℃(在最小稳态时间内);
(7)在设定温度发生突变(温度变化±20℃)时,用液晶屏显示水温随时间变化的实时曲线(最少显示两个波动周期);
一、系统方案:
1方案论证与比较:
1)测量部分:
方案1:
采用AD590集成电流输出型两端温度传感器,在被测温度一定时,相当于一个恒流源。具有良好的测量精度和线性度。但AD590的线性电流输出为1uA/K,很容易受环境干扰及运放温漂的影响。使温度的测量精度降低。
方案2:
采用DS18B20即总线的温度测量器件,具有体积小,线路简单的特点。但测量精度低,不易满足题目中的扩展要求。
方案3:
采用PT100热电阻。铂电阻是用很细的铂丝(~)绕在云母支架上制成,是国际公认的高精度测温标准传感器。因为铂电阻在氧化性介质中,甚至高温下其物理、化学性质都非常稳定,因此它具有精度高、稳定性好、性能可靠的特点。因此铂电阻在中温(-200~650℃)范围内得到广泛应用。
选用方案3,PT100的灵敏度很高,精度高、稳定性好、性能可靠,/℃,结合桥式测温电路,及AD采样中的软件滤波,实现了高精度,高灵敏度的测温。
2)控制部分:
方案1:
采用DC-AC的交流继电器控制加热管的工作,加热管接通几个周期再断开几个周期来调节加在负载上的功率大小,即交流调功的方法。降温采用DC-DC直流继电器控制贴于器皿底部的半导体制冷片的工作,实现降温。
方案2:
采用双向可控硅构成的交流调压电路,在电网电压的每个周期都对加给负载的电压进行控制,实现电压的平稳调节,从而实现升温平稳。降温采用液冷的方式,用DC-AC固态继电器控制水泵循环水,制冷片为循环水降温。
选用方案2,处理器捕获交流电的上升及下降沿,控制移相触发脉冲,对负载的有效功率进行高精度的控制,有利于升温的平稳行,动态误差和静态误差水平都有显著的提高。降温控制时由液体的流动带走水的温度,同时采用半导体制冷